Explain the following reaction with the balanced equation.
Chlorine dissolved in water
Advertisements
उत्तर
Chlorine dissolves in water to form hypochlorous acid and hydrochloric acid.
\[\ce{\underset{\text{Chlorine}}{Cl_{2(g)}} + \underset{\text{Water}}{H2O_{(l)}} -> \underset{\text{Hypochlorous acid}}{HOCl_{(aq)}} + \underset{\text{Hydrochloric acid}}{HCl_{(aq)}}}\]
